1. A sample of 50 students’ exam scores is taken, with an average score of 82. The population
standard deviation is known to be 8. Construct a 95% confidence interval for the true mean
exam score of the population.
2. A factory's machine fills bottles with an average of 500 ml, based on a sample of 100 bottles.
The population standard deviation is known to be 5 ml. Find a 90% confidence interval for
the mean volume filled by the machine.
3. A quality control manager wants to estimate the mean diameter of bearings produced in a
factory. A sample of 70 bearings has a mean diameter of 0.65 cm. The population standard
deviation is known to be 0.05 cm. Construct a 99% confidence interval for the population
mean diameter.
4. A random sample of 80 packages is weighed, with a sample mean weight of 2.1 kg. The
population standard deviation of weights is known to be 0.3 kg. Find a 95% confidence
interval for the true mean weight of packages.

7. The mean weight of 200 male students in a college is 60 kilograms with standard deviation of
4 kilograms. test the hypothesis that the mean weight in the population is greater than 58
kilograms. Use 1% level of significance.
8. Average returns in equity mutual funds of company are supposed to be 15% p.a. with a std.
deviation of 2.5%. A sample of 40 investors is randomly selected and their mean return is
found to be 13.3%. Test at 5% level of significance whether there is any significant difference
between the sample mean and population mean? What will be the result if the level of
significance is 1%?
